Partager via


CWnd::accLocation

Appelé par l'infrastructure pour récupérer l'emplacement actuel de l'écran de l'objet spécifié.

virtual HRESULT accLocation( 
   long *pxLeft, 
   long *pyTop, 
   long *pcxWidth, 
   long *pcyHeight, 
   VARIANT varChild 
);

Paramètres

  • pxLeft
    Accepte la coordonnée x du coin supérieur gauche de l'objet (dans des unités d'écran).

  • pyTop
    Accepte l'ordonnée du coin supérieur gauche de l'objet (dans des unités d'écran).

  • pcxWidth
    Accepte la largeur de l'objet (dans des unités d'écran).

  • pcyHeight
    Accepte la hauteur de l'objet (dans des unités d'écran).

  • varChild
    Spécifie si l'emplacement récupérer est celui de l'objet ou de celui des éléments enfants de l'objet. Ce paramètre peut être CHILDID_SELF (pour obtenir des informations sur l'objet) ou un ID enfant (pour obtenir des informations sur l'élément enfant de l'objet).

Valeur de retour

Retourne S_OK en cas de réussite, le code d'erreur COM en cas de échec. Consultez Valeurs de retour dans IAccessible::accLocation dans Kit de développement logiciel Windows.

Notes

Remplacez cette fonction dans votre CWndclasse dérivée si vous avez des éléments de l'interface utilisateur sans fenêtre (autre que les contrôles ActiveX sans fenêtre, qui gère des MFC).

Pour plus d'informations, consultez l' IAccessible::accLocation dans Kit de développement logiciel Windows.

Configuration requise

Header: afxwin.h

Voir aussi

Référence

CWnd, classe

Graphique de la hiérarchie

CWnd::accHitTest